Life Near Two Popular Towns

The port city of Wilmington, a short drive from East Wynd, has grown considerably since its founding in 1739 but has not lost its small-town feel. Stroll, shop, and dine along the popular Riverwalk. Explore mansions, museums, and sites galore in Wilmington’s historic district. Immerse yourself in nature escapes at Airlie Gardens and the New Hanover County Arboretum. On Topsail Island, Surf City is home to an iconic fishing pier, seaside restaurants, and boutique shopping. Enjoy outdoor movies and concerts at the waterfront Soundside Park, just one of Surf City’s ample offerings.

With mild winters and balmy summers, the coastal Carolinas have some of America’s most desirable weather. Making it the perfect place to enjoy outdoor activities, of which there are plenty at The Bluffs!

Over 600 acres are available for roaming. Around 25% of the community is protected green space, with nature trails winding through tall, mature trees and flowering shrubs. A private fishing lake, with a launch for paddle boats and kayaks, is stocked with bass and bream.

Boating enthusiasts love the private marina and boat launch alongside a waterfront park with shade pavilions. A 25-minute boat ride down the Cape Fear River delivers you to historic Downtown Wilmington!

Set just back from the Atlantic, Hampstead is a growing, close-knit town firmly rooted in coastal charm stretching back to colonial times. Much of the natural surroundings have remained untouched since the town’s founding in the 1700s. Extensive wooded areas and nature preserves give way to horse ranches and farms all around Hampstead.

Your Summer Maintenance Checklist

Even if the weather is already heating up, most of these tasks can be done indoors, allowing you to focus on enjoying the sunshine. Here’s a brief overview of the tasks you can complete:

  • Oil garage-door opener and chain, garage door, and all door hinges.
  • Remove lint from your dryer vent.
  • Clean kitchen exhaust fan filter.
  • Clean refrigerator and freezer coils and empty and clean drip trays.
  • Check the dishwasher for leaks.
  • Check around kitchen and bathroom cabinets and around toilets for leaks.
  • Replace interior and exterior faucet and showerhead washers if needed.
  • Seal tile grout.

One recent afternoon, we were invited to join the team of the Carousel Child Advocacy Center in Wilmington, an agency long supported by Hagood Homes.

Members of the team got a closer look at the facility and met members of the staff, who gave an in-depth view of the work done on behalf of those it serves.

The Carousel Child Advocacy Center is called to aid child survivors of abuse and neglect, and their families, whether it is through victim support, medical services and forensic interviews, therapeutic services, case management, or a host of other activities that ensure that children who are survivors of abuse can heal, recover, thrive, and shine.

And most of all, Carousel Center professionals are advocates when children of abuse don’t have a voice of their own.
